This savory steak dish was brought to the Cape of South Africa by Malay workers during Dutch colonial settlement. Capetown Masala is the heart (and heat!) of the flavor. Serves 4 1/4 cup freshly ground Capetown Masala 1 teaspoon fine sea salt, or to taste 2 tablespoons grated fresh ginger 3 garlic cloves, minced 2 pound cube steak, cut into large pieces 2 large onions, sliced 2 tablespoons vegetable oil 2 cups chicken stock 1 large tomato, seeded and diced Combine Masala, salt, ginger and garlic in a medium-sized bowl.
